The Dangers of Uncontrolled Water Pressure
Protecting Your Plumbing from Excessive Force
High water pressure entering your home might seem like a good thing for shower power, but it can be incredibly damaging to your entire plumbing system. Constant pressure exceeding the recommended levels puts undue stress on pipes, fixtures, and appliances designed to operate within a specific pressure range. This stress accelerates wear and tear, leading to premature failure of faucets, toilets, showerheads, and even major appliances like water heaters, dishwashers, and washing machines.
Beyond the physical damage, excessive water pressure wastes water and energy. Higher flow rates mean more water is used unnecessarily with every tap opened or flush made. Furthermore, pumps within appliances work harder under high pressure, potentially increasing energy consumption and reducing their lifespan. Uncontrolled pressure can also cause annoying and potentially damaging water hammer noise throughout the pipes.
How Pressure Reducing Valves Work
A Pressure Reducing Valve, often abbreviated as PRV, is a crucial plumbing component installed on the main water supply line entering your home. Its primary function is to lower the high incoming municipal water pressure to a safe, constant, and manageable level suitable for your home’s internal plumbing. Think of it as a governor for your water system, ensuring that while the pressure outside may fluctuate, the pressure inside remains steady and safe.
The PRV uses a diaphragm and spring mechanism to regulate pressure. When incoming pressure is too high, it pushes against the diaphragm, closing a valve inside and restricting flow until the downstream pressure drops to the set point. This continuous automatic adjustment ensures that no matter how high the street pressure is, the pressure delivered to your faucets and fixtures remains within the optimal range, typically between 50 and 80 PSI.
Long-Term Advantages for Your Home
Installing or maintaining a functional Pressure Reducing Valve offers significant long-term benefits for your home and wallet. By keeping pressure within the recommended range, you dramatically extend the life of your plumbing fixtures, appliances, and piping. This preventative measure saves you money on frequent repairs and premature replacements of expensive items like water heaters, washing machines, and dishwashers.
Furthermore, properly regulated pressure helps conserve water. Without excessive pressure pushing through pipes and fixtures, less water is consumed during daily activities, leading to lower water bills. Additionally, reduced water usage can indirectly save energy, especially when heating water, contributing to lower utility costs overall.
Consistent water pressure throughout your home improves the performance of showers and faucets and eliminates irritating noises like banging pipes (water hammer) often associated with high pressure. It provides peace of mind knowing your plumbing system is operating safely and efficiently, protected from the stresses of uncontrolled municipal supply pressure.

Expert Pressure Reducing Valve Services
Installation, Repair, and Maintenance
If you notice signs of potential high water pressure issues like noisy pipes, leaking fixtures, or rapidly failing appliances, your Pressure Reducing Valve may need attention. PRVs are mechanical devices and can eventually wear out or fail over time, leading to either excessively high or uncomfortably low water pressure throughout the house. A failing valve can also cause pressure to surge unexpectedly, putting your system at risk.
Diagnosing PRV issues and ensuring proper installation, repair, or replacement requires the expertise of licensed plumbing professionals. Attempting DIY repairs on a PRV can lead to incorrect pressure settings, potential damage to your plumbing system, or even water damage if not handled correctly. Professional service ensures the valve is properly sized, installed in the correct location, and calibrated to the optimal pressure setting for your home.
